1
+ # Cbc Ruby
2
+
3
+ [Cbc](https://github.com/coin-or/Cbc) - the mixed-integer programming solver - for Ruby
4
+
5
+ [![Build Status](https://github.com/ankane/cbc-ruby/workflows/build/badge.svg?branch=master)](https://github.com/ankane/cbc-ruby/actions)
6
+
7
+ ## Installation
8
+
9
+ First, install Cbc. For Homebrew, use:
10
+
11
+ ```sh
12
+ brew install cbc
13
+ ```
14
+
15
+ And for Ubuntu, use:
16
+
17
+ ```sh
18
+ sudo apt-get install coinor-libcbc3
19
+ ```
20
+
21
+ Then add this line to your application’s Gemfile:
22
+
23
+ ```ruby
24
+ gem "cbc"
25
+ ```
26
+
27
+ ## Getting Started
28
+
29
+ *The API is fairly low-level at the moment*
30
+
31
+ Load a problem
32
+
33
+ ```ruby
34
+ model =
35
+ Cbc.load_problem(
36
+ sense: :minimize,
37
+ start: [0, 3, 6],
38
+ index: [0, 1, 2, 0, 1, 2],
39
+ value: [2, 3, 2, 2, 4, 1],
40
+ col_lower: [0, 0],
41
+ col_upper: [1e30, 1e30],
42
+ obj: [8, 10],
43
+ row_lower: [7, 12, 6],
44
+ row_upper: [1e30, 1e30, 1e30],
45
+ col_type: [:integer, :continuous]
46
+ )
47
+ ```
48
+
49
+ Solve
50
+
51
+ ```ruby
52
+ model.solve
53
+ ```
54
+
55
+ Write the problem to an LP or MPS file (LP requires Cbc 2.10.0+)
56
+
57
+ ```ruby
58
+ model.write_lp("hello.lp")
59
+ # or
60
+ model.write_mps("hello") # adds mps.gz
61
+ ```
62
+
63
+ Read a problem from an LP or MPS file (LP requires Cbc 2.10.0+)
64
+
65
+ ```ruby
66
+ model = Cbc.read_lp("hello.lp")
67
+ # or
68
+ model = Cbc.read_mps("hello.mps.gz")
69
+ ```
70
+
71
+ ## Reference
72
+
73
+ Set the log level (requires Cbc 2.10.0+)
74
+
75
+ ```ruby
76
+ model.solve(log_level: 1) # 0 = off, 3 = max
77
+ ```
78
+
79
+ Set the time limit in seconds (requires Cbc 2.10.0+)
80
+
81
+ ```ruby
82
+ model.solve(time_limit: 30)
83
+ ```

data/lib/cbc/ffi.rb ADDED
@@ -0,0 +1,83 @@
1
+ module Cbc
2
+ module FFI
3
+ extend Fiddle::Importer
4
+
5
+ libs = Array(Cbc.ffi_lib).dup
6
+ begin
7
+ dlload Fiddle.dlopen(libs.shift)
8
+ rescue Fiddle::DLError => e
9
+ retry if libs.any?
10
+ raise e
11
+ end
12
+
13
+ # https://github.com/coin-or/Cbc/blob/releases/2.9.9/Cbc/src/Cbc_C_Interface.h
14
+
15
+ OBJ_SENSE = {
16
+ minimize: 1,
17
+ ignore: 0,
18
+ maximize: -1
19
+ }
20
+
21
+ STATUS = {
22
+ -1 => :not_started,
23
+ 0 => :finished,
24
+ 1 => :stopped,
25
+ 2 => :abandoned,
26
+ 5 => :interrupted
27
+ }
28
+
29
+ SECONDARY_STATUS = {
30
+ -1 => :unset,
31
+ 0 => :completed,
32
+ 1 => :infeasible,
33
+ 2 => :stopped_gap,
34
+ 3 => :stopped_nodes,
35
+ 4 => :stopped_time,
36
+ 5 => :stopped_user,
37
+ 6 => :stopped_solutions,
38
+ 7 => :unbounded,
39
+ 8 => :stopped_iterations
40
+ }
41
+
42
+ typealias "CoinBigIndex", "int"
43
+
44
+ # version info
45
+ extern "char * Cbc_getVersion(void)"
46
+
47
+ # load models
48
+ extern "Cbc_Model * Cbc_newModel(void)"
49
+ extern "void Cbc_loadProblem(Cbc_Model *model, int numcols, int numrows, CoinBigIndex *start, int *index, double *value, double *collb, double *colub, double *obj, double *rowlb, double *rowub)"
50
+ extern "void Cbc_setObjSense(Cbc_Model *model, double sense)"
51
+ extern "int Cbc_isInteger(Cbc_Model * model, int i)"
52
+ extern "void Cbc_setContinuous(Cbc_Model *model, int iColumn)"
53
+ extern "void Cbc_setInteger(Cbc_Model *model, int iColumn)"
54
+ extern "void Cbc_deleteModel(Cbc_Model *model)"
55
+
56
+ # read and write
57
+ extern "int Cbc_readMps(Cbc_Model *model, char *filename)"
58
+ extern "void Cbc_writeMps(Cbc_Model *model, char *filename)"
59
+
60
+ # solve
61
+ extern "int Cbc_getNumCols(Cbc_Model *model)"
62
+ extern "int Cbc_getNumRows(Cbc_Model *model)"
63
+ extern "int Cbc_solve(Cbc_Model *model)"
64
+ extern "double * Cbc_getColSolution(Cbc_Model *model)"
65
+ extern "int Cbc_isAbandoned(Cbc_Model *model)"
66
+ extern "int Cbc_isProvenOptimal(Cbc_Model *model)"
67
+ extern "int Cbc_isProvenInfeasible(Cbc_Model *model)"
68
+ extern "int Cbc_isContinuousUnbounded(Cbc_Model *model)"
69
+ extern "double Cbc_getObjValue(Cbc_Model *model)"
70
+ extern "int Cbc_status(Cbc_Model *model)"
71
+ extern "int Cbc_secondaryStatus(Cbc_Model *model)"
72
+
73
+ if Gem::Version.new(FFI.Cbc_getVersion.to_s) >= Gem::Version.new("2.10.0")
74
+ extern "int Cbc_readLp(Cbc_Model *model, char *filename)"
75
+ extern "void Cbc_writeLp(Cbc_Model *model, char *filename)"
76
+
77
+ extern "double Cbc_getMaximumSeconds(Cbc_Model *model)"
78
+ extern "void Cbc_setMaximumSeconds(Cbc_Model *model, double maxSeconds)"
79
+ extern "int Cbc_getLogLevel(Cbc_Model *model)"
80
+ extern "void Cbc_setLogLevel(Cbc_Model *model, int logLevel)"
81
+ end
82
+ end
83
+ end
data/lib/cbc/model.rb ADDED
@@ -0,0 +1,154 @@
1
+ module Cbc
2
+ class Model
3
+ def initialize
4
+ @model = FFI.Cbc_newModel
5
+ ObjectSpace.define_finalizer(self, self.class.finalize(@model))
6
+
7
+ @below210 = Gem::Version.new(Cbc.lib_version) < Gem::Version.new("2.10.0")
8
+ FFI.Cbc_setLogLevel(model, 0) unless @below210
9
+ end
10
+
11
+ def load_problem(sense:, start:, index:, value:, col_lower:, col_upper:, obj:, row_lower:, row_upper:, col_type:)
12
+ start_size = start.size
13
+ index_size = index.size
14
+ num_cols = col_lower.size
15
+ num_rows = row_lower.size
16
+
17
+ FFI.Cbc_loadProblem(
18
+ model, num_cols, num_rows,
19
+ big_index_array(start, start_size), int_array(index, index_size), double_array(value, index_size),
20
+ double_array(col_lower, num_cols), double_array(col_upper, num_cols), double_array(obj, num_cols),
21
+ double_array(row_lower, num_rows), double_array(row_upper, num_rows)
22
+ )
23
+ FFI.Cbc_setObjSense(model, FFI::OBJ_SENSE.fetch(sense))
24
+
25
+ if col_type.size != num_cols
26
+ raise ArgumentError, "wrong size (given #{value.size}, expected #{size})"
27
+ end
28
+
29
+ col_type.each_with_index do |v, i|
30
+ case v
31
+ when :integer
32
+ FFI.Cbc_setInteger(model, i)
33
+ when :continuous
34
+ FFI.Cbc_setContinuous(model, i)
35
+ else
36
+ raise ArgumentError, "Unknown col_type"
37
+ end
38
+ end
39
+ end
40
+
41
+ def read_lp(filename)
42
+ check_version
43
+ check_status FFI.Cbc_readLp(model, filename)
44
+ end
45
+
46
+ def read_mps(filename)
47
+ check_status FFI.Cbc_readMps(model, filename)
48
+ end
49
+
50
+ def write_lp(filename)
51
+ check_version
52
+ FFI.Cbc_writeLp(model, filename)
53
+ end
54
+
55
+ def write_mps(filename)
56
+ FFI.Cbc_writeMps(model, filename)
57
+ end
58
+
59
+ def solve(log_level: nil, time_limit: nil)
60
+ with_options(log_level: log_level, time_limit: time_limit) do
61
+ # do not check status
62
+ FFI.Cbc_solve(model)
63
+ end
64
+
65
+ num_cols = FFI.Cbc_getNumCols(model)
66
+
67
+ status = FFI::STATUS[FFI.Cbc_status(model)]
68
+ secondary_status = FFI::SECONDARY_STATUS[FFI.Cbc_secondaryStatus(model)]
69
+
70
+ ret_status =
71
+ case status
72
+ when :not_started, :finished
73
+ if FFI.Cbc_isProvenOptimal(model)
74
+ :optimal
75
+ elsif FFI.Cbc_isProvenInfeasible(model)
76
+ :infeasible
77
+ else
78
+ secondary_status
79
+ end
80
+ else
81
+ secondary_status
82
+ end
83
+
84
+ {
85
+ status: ret_status,
86
+ objective: FFI.Cbc_getObjValue(model),
87
+ primal_col: read_double_array(FFI.Cbc_getColSolution(model), num_cols)
88
+ }
89
+ end
90
+
91
+ def self.finalize(model)
92
+ # must use proc instead of stabby lambda
93
+ proc { FFI.Cbc_deleteModel(model) }
94
+ end
95
+
96
+ private
97
+
98
+ def model
99
+ @model
100
+ end
101
+
102
+ def check_status(status)
103
+ if status != 0
104
+ raise Error, "Bad status: #{status}"
105
+ end
106
+ end
107
+
108
+ def check_version
109
+ if @below210
110
+ raise Error, "This feature requires Cbc 2.10.0+"
111
+ end
112
+ end
113
+
114
+ def double_array(value, size)
115
+ base_array(value, size, "d")
116
+ end
117
+
118
+ def int_array(value, size)
119
+ base_array(value, size, "i!")
120
+ end
121
+ alias_method :big_index_array, :int_array
122
+
123
+ def base_array(value, size, format)
124
+ if value.size != size
125
+ # TODO add variable name to message
126
+ raise ArgumentError, "wrong size (given #{value.size}, expected #{size})"
127
+ end
128
+ Fiddle::Pointer[value.pack("#{format}#{size}")]
129
+ end
130
+
131
+ def read_double_array(ptr, size)
132
+ ptr[0, size * Fiddle::SIZEOF_DOUBLE].unpack("d#{size}")
133
+ end
134
+
135
+ def with_options(log_level:, time_limit:)
136
+ if log_level
137
+ check_version
138
+ previous_log_level = FFI.Cbc_getLogLevel(model)
139
+ FFI.Cbc_setLogLevel(model, log_level)
140
+ end
141
+
142
+ if time_limit
143
+ check_version
144
+ previous_time_limit = FFI.Cbc_getMaximumSeconds(model)
145
+ FFI.Cbc_setMaximumSeconds(model, time_limit)
146
+ end
147
+
148
+ yield
149
+ ensure
150
+ FFI.Cbc_setLogLevel(model, previous_log_level) if previous_log_level
151
+ FFI.Cbc_setMaximumSeconds(model, previous_time_limit) if previous_time_limit
152
+ end
153
+ end
154
+ end
